It\u2019s hard to imagine Hong Kong\u2019s streets without these vibrant and colourful signage boards. Yet,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.bd.gov.hk\/en\/building-works\/signboards\/index.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">tightening building regulations<\/a> mean the familiar hue that once shrouded our cityscape is being stripped away one sign at a time. While the future of neon signs may be dimming, craftspeople and contemporary artists in Hong Kong are fighting to salvage and preserve the city\u2019s representative glow in alternative ways.<\/p>\n<p>We speak with grandfather-grandson duo, neon craftsman Wong Kin-wah (\u9ec3\u5065\u83ef) and contemporary artist Jerry Loo, about their latest collaborative exhibition, <em>Neon Heroes: Illuminated Dreams<\/em> taking place at PMQ. Whether big or small, I\u2019ve made plenty,\u201d Master Wong recalls his journey in the neon industry fondly. \u201cAll along Nathan Road, and also [on the front of] bars in Wan Chai\u2019s Lockhart Road, you\u2019ll see some of my work.\u201d<\/p>\n<h3>Adapt, innovate, create<\/h3>\n<figure id=\"attachment_222854\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-222854\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-222854 size-medium l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-close-up-900x643.jpg\" alt=\"neon heroes exhibition shot\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-close-up-900x643.jpg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-close-up-768x549.jpg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-close-up.jpg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-222854\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">The exhibition showcases the process of neon sign making<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>\u201cThis installation shows how neon craftspeople adapted technologies of the trade as they were imported from the west,\u201d explains Loo, gesturing towards the replica of a tool used to heat glass tubes used in neon sign crafting. \u201cThere are many more twists and turns when crafting signs with Chinese characters than the English alphabet. To make a character from a single glass tube is a testament to the craftsman\u2019s skills.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t\u2019s all hands-on work,\u201d Master Wong explains the process of bending a straight glass tube into shape. \u201c[The characters on] neon signs are made of glass, which is a technique that\u2019s hard to mechanise. Signs are two-dimensional, and we trace a draft with the glass tube through repeated rounds of heating, twisting, and glass blowing.\u201d<\/p>\n<h3>A feat of engineering and alchemy<\/h3>\n<figure id=\"attachment_222853\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-222853\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-222853 size-medium l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-blue-installation-900x643.jpg\" alt=\"neon heroes deep thought ice blue neon shop signs neon signs\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-blue-installation-900x643.jpg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-blue-installation-768x549.jpg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-blue-installation.jpg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-222853\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">The enchanting hue of <em>Deep Thought, Ice Blue<\/em> comes from a meticulous crafting process<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>\u201cEvery design starts with a white glass tube. To get different colours, you need to coat the inside of the tube with a powder,\u201d Master Wong gestured towards the blue- and yellow-hued installations around the exhibition. \u201cFor green, you need to add argon gas when you vacuumise the tube. To get a reddish-orange, you add neon gas. There is a lot of variety, and people always say my work is like a scientist\u2019s!\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I wanted to make some very intricate designs for the exhibition,\u201d says Loo. \u201cBut since I want visitors to interact with [the installations], I have to take safety and other concerns into account and work on each piece with my grandfather and his team of craftsmen.\u201d Master Wong reinforces the intricacies of working with an extra plane: \u201cThree-dimensional designs are different; you need another formula for those.\u201d<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_222860\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-222860\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-222860 size-medium l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-superhero-landing-900x643.jpg\" alt=\"neon heroes superhero landing\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-superhero-landing-900x643.jpg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-superhero-landing-768x549.jpg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-superhero-landing.jpg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-222860\" class=\"wp-caption-text\"><em>Neon Heroes<\/em> primarily features interactive exhibits<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>\u201cFor example, <em>Superhero Landing<\/em> is a three-dimensional design,\u201d Loo gestures towards the centrepiece in the Courtyard. \u201cIt&#8217;s essentially a glass tube spiral, and the production process is very different from your usual neon signs. But the craftsmen were very eager and open to trying new techniques and designs despite the lack of familiarity.\u201d<\/p>\n<h3>A dwindling heritage or revived legacy?<\/h3>\n<figure id=\"attachment_222857\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-222857\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-222857 size-medium l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-group-photo-900x643.jpg\" alt=\"group shot neon shop signs neon signs neon lights\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-group-photo-900x643.jpg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-group-photo-768x549.jpg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2025\/07\/neon-sign-master-interview-group-photo.jpg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-222857\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Master Wong and Jerry Loo posing in front of <em>The Dragon Within<\/em><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>\u201cI\u2019ve made many neon shop signs in my time, but many have been removed,\u201d Master Wong reminisces with a bittersweet smile. \u201cThe decline [of neon shop signs] on public buildings comes from a mandate to register with the Building Department, which increases the cost of commissioning and owning a sign, which can become burdensome for small businesses.\u201d Yet, Master Wong remains hopeful about the future of neon signs in Hong Kong.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I hope this will help get the word out about neon shop signs,\u201d comments Master Wong on <em>Neon Heroes<\/em>. \u201cThere are a lot of young people who come to me to learn [about neon sign crafting], but for most of them, it\u2019s only an interest. They have their own careers, so it\u2019s difficult to pick it up full-time.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cNeon signs will change with the times,\u201d muses Loo. \u201cSo will people and places. We might not see neon signs on the streets as much, but they will evolve and look towards a more artistic future. I don\u2019t think neon signs must be tied to nostalgia. Those who appreciate their beauty can still find nostalgic value in more artistic interpretations.\u201d<\/p>\n<h4><em>Neon Heroes: Illuminated Dreams<\/em><\/h4>\n<p><strong>Date<\/strong>: Until 7 July 2025<br \/>\n<strong>Address<\/strong>: Courtyard and Marketplace, PMQ, 35 Aberdeen Road, Sheung Wan, Hong Kong<\/p>\n<p><a class=\"button\" href=\"https:\/\/www.instagram.com\/jerry.verse0.0\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">Connect with Jerry Loo<\/a><\/p>\n<p><em>What Hong Kong heritage should I explore next?
